About Ingoldisthorpe Village Sign
What you're getting is a quiet moment of village heritage, nothing grand or time-consuming. Spend five minutes examining it properly, ten if you're taking photographs or you're genuinely interested in the craftsmanship. It's absolutely free, naturally - it's just sat there by the roadside. Best visited in daylight, obviously, and there's no specific season that makes a difference.
This works well as a stop-off if you're touring the area between King's Lynn and the coast. The nearby holiday parks - Pinecones and Diglea are closest at under two miles - make it handy for a morning or afternoon walk. If you're staying at Heacham Beach or any of the Parkdean sites further along, it's a gentle detour that takes no planning or effort. Won't occupy your whole afternoon, but it's exactly the sort of small discovery that makes a caravan holiday feel less like ticking boxes and more like actually exploring Norfolk. The quietness of Ingoldisthorpe itself is rather nice too - you can wander the village for twenty minutes if the mood takes you.
